I have a Kawasaki klt200a duckster. I'm trying to remove the clutch cover in order to get the starter chain back on (i have removed starter) . I'm not sure the exact process, and I certainty do not want to break this aluminum cover. I have removed all screws but it is still sealed up. Any help appreciated.
-
You could try to tap on the edge of the cover with a rubber mallet or a dead blow. Don't use anything hard or you could damage something and have it not seal when you put it back together.
-
I am not sure if something else needs removed before cover will come off. The clutch arm goes up through the botom of this cover too .
